الگوریتم های فرا ابتکاری
الگوریتم های فرا ابتکاری یا MetaHeurestic زیر مجموعه ای از الگورتیم های بهینه سازی برای حل مسائل بصورت تقریبی هستند. این الگوریتم ها برای حل مشکلات الگوریتم های ابتکاری یا Heurestic بوجود آمده اند که مسئله محور نیستند و پاسخ به مسائل متنوعی می توانند استفاده شوند.
الگوریتم فراابتکاری
روش های ابتکاری یا تعداد بسیار کمی راه حل را تضمین و ارائه می کنند یعنی یک الگوریتم را نمی توان برای مسائل مختلف دیگر استفاده کرد و یا در نقطه بهینه ضعیف محلی local و نامطمئنی متوقف می شوند که این امر به دلیل وجود روش های تکرار بهبود یافته، است. الگوریتم فراابتکاری به منظور حل این مشکلات ارائه شده است. این روش که از دهه 80 میلادی ارائه شده است به حل مسائلی با بهینه سازی سخت کارایی دارد.
تعریف الگوریتم فراابتکاری
الگوریتم های فرا ابتکاری در واقع مجموعه ای از الگوریتم ها هستند که بر روی الگوریتم های ابتکاری اعمال می شوند و باعث رهایی از بهینه سازی محلی می شوند و در عین حال امکان استفاده از الگوریتم های ابتکاری را در تعداد زیادی از مسائل می دهند. ما در بالا به دو مشکل بهینه سازی محلی و محدود بودن راه حل ها برای الگوریتم های ابتکاری اشاره کردیم که این دو مشکل با ظهور الگوریتم های فراابتکاری از بین می روند.
در تعریفی مشابه میتوانیم بگوییم که فرا ابتکاری، یک چارچوب عمومی الگوریتمیک است که می تواند با تغییرات کمی روی مسائل گوناگون راه حل های مخصوص به همان مسئله را ارائه کند (بر خلاف الگوریتم ابتکاری که فقط مختص به یک مسئله بود)
نمایش 1–9 از 84 نتیجه